基于B/S模式选课系统的设计与实现
这是一篇关于J2EE,课程,选课,MVC,SQL Server的论文, 主要内容为当前无纸化办公的普遍推广,计算机网络硬件系统的社会普及,信息的自动处理以及网络式的信息交互方式已经被人们广泛应用,这为实现信息化学生管理铺垫了坚实的基础,而网络在线选课是其中一部分。在科技兴国战略的指导下,应用计算机来管理学生的信息是现在各个高职院校都在积极进行的工作之一,也是各校教育教学工作管理的重要内容。网上选课的方式相比人工选课更能节省资源,也更充分体现学生选课的自主权。在每学期初学生结合选课系统的调节来选择课程,从而合理的完成了各种教学资源的均匀分配。因而运用在线系统辅助选课,能实时地检索和汇总繁多的选课数据,并且选课结果容易输出,大大降低工作量,提高了选课工作管理的效率,同时也避免了人工处理时容易产生差错的问题。所以开发针对我校的需求和特点,开发适合我院师生使用的选课系统是形势所趋,是实现现代化教育的必然。本文将从开发该在线选课系统所采用的相关工具、基本技术介绍开始,经过系统的需求分析和可行性研究形成系统的逻辑模型,再通过系统功能模块描述和数据库的设计、代码设计完成最后的系统实现。 本在线系统的开发采用以J2EE架构为基础的应用程序开发技术,开发基于瘦客户端(B/S结构)模式的选课系统,其系统开发的服务器应用Tomcat。因为在线选课系统的逻辑关系比较复杂,在开发设计中采用JSP结合使用了JavaBean组件来解决程序中遇到的复杂逻辑问题,从而使系统的业务逻辑与客户端显示页面进行了分离。数据库管理是开发在线选课系统中重要的一个部分,为了实现数据库对Web技术的支持和良好的伸缩性,此系统开发中使用SQLServer2000作为数据库管理系统,从而使系统具有较高的安全性和良好的性能。 该在线选课系统的主要用户是管理员、教师和学生,主要包括三大功能模块:管理员系统模块、教师系统模块、学生系统模块。其中管理员模块主要有用户管理、课程信息管理、选课信息管理等模块;教师系统模块主要有教师课程管理、成绩管理、个人信息管理等模块;学生系统模块主要有学生课程管理、成绩查询、个人信息管理等模块。通过整体分析在线选课系统的数据对象和逻辑结构,本着以开发安全稳定的系统为准则,完成了后台数据库的规划。依据整体设想方案,采用自下而上的方法来逐层实现系统功能,经过逐步系统检测测试,结果表明该系统运行基本稳定。 在线选课系统各模块的基本功能得到实现,课程管理与选课的功能完成是整个系统设计中的关键部分。本论文主要介绍系统开发过程中结构的设计过程,对整个系统的设计思想以及开发过程中遇到的技术难点和解决方案进行了详细说明。
新高考背景下基于学业水平考试的体育课程设计研究
这是一篇关于课程,体育课程设计,新高考,学业水平考试,普通高中的论文, 主要内容为课程设计是一种教育术语,通常释义为“为掌握课程内容所进行的设计”,也可以诠释成“为一门课程进行教学策划的研究活动”。在我国课程改革大力推行素质教育的背景下,我国的体育课程改革正在发生着纵向深入发展,对体育课程的研究也表现出了百花齐放的局面,新课标为体育课程设计提供了政策上的保障。河北省普通高中体育课程在课程内容的多样性方面相对薄弱,缺少新鲜的内容,体育课程教学内容并没有因为新高考改革而发生改变,体育课程内容乏味、枯燥、学生高中三年并没有学会一项体育运动项目,学业水平考试(体育)形同虚设,所以,普通高中体育课程设计有待研究。高中生的身体和心理正处于发展的关键时期,体育运动对高中阶段的学生的身心健康发展有着极大的作用,本研究从普通高中体育课程设计出发,以河北省10所普通高中为调查对象,对普通高中体育课程设计进行了较为详细的背景分析以及设计方案研究,经过河北省普通高中体育课程设计现状和课程实施现状的调查分析,探究河北省普通高中体育课程设计存在的问题,通过以学年为单位,依据新高考、新课标、学业水平考试,结合学生的年龄、心理特点,将体育课程的目标、内容、评价进行了合理规划,对体育课程的实施提出了建议,体现出了体育课程内容的延展性,使学业水平考试与学生的身心健康发展更好地结合到一起。体育课程设计的合理性、创新性有利于调动学生体育运动的积极性,也有助于体育课程教学效果的提升。本研究采用文献资料法对相关的课程设计文献进行梳理,为本研究提供了理论基础;运用文本分析法对河北省普通高中现有的体育课程设计进行了分析;运用访谈法和问卷调查法对河北省普通高中体育课程实施的现状进行了调查,并运用数理统计法对调查结果进行了整理与分析;最后在体育课程设计的学业评价设计中运用到了特尔菲法,确定了最合理的评价标准。领略了新高考政策和《普通高中体育与健康课程标准(2017年版2020年修订)》的基本要求,依据实际调查结果和课程设计模式理论,以及高中生的身心发展特点和规律,并结合河北省普通高中的实际教学条件的情况下,有针对性地对河北省普通高中体育课程进行设计研究。研究内容主要是基于学业水平考试的高中体育课程设计的研究概述(新高考对高中体育课程设计的影响、学业水平考试对体育课程设计的影响、高中体育课程设计研究内容的确定)、基于学业水平考试的高中体育课程设计和课程实施的现状与分析,以及新高考背景下基于学业水平考试的高中体育课程设计(高中体育课程设计的理论依据、指导思想、基本原则,学年课程目标设计,学年课程内容构建与实施建议,学年课程评价开发)等方面进行了系统地阐述,研究结果如下:(1)对新高考对高中体育课程设计的影响、学业水平考试对体育课程设计的影响进行了概述,并确定了高中体育课程设计的研究内容。新高考改革后,对传统高中体育课程提出了新的要求,同时也提出了新的挑战,传统的体育课程设计已经无法满足当下课程需求。(2)河北省普通高中现有的体育课程设计大致符合新课标的要求,但与新高考政策和学业水平考试制度不符,课程实施存在着对体育课程重视程度不够、学校对体育设施投入不足,体育教师培训较少、老龄化严重、教学知识滞后、教学成就感不足、课程内容选择面小,学生对体育课程的学习目的不明确、对新课标、新高考、学业水平考试理解不彻底、三年学不会一项体育运动等情况。(3)本研究尝试性地在新高考改革的大环境下,依据《普通高中体育与健康课程标准》和体育课程的延续性,把水平五分为三个学年,设计的体育课程目标呈现出了层次性、构建的课程内容呈现出大单元教学合理性并提出了实施建议、开发了精准促进性的学业评价,这样既可以促进教师创设灵活的教学形式,合理的选择教学内容并有序组织,又不仅限于学业水平考试某一套试题的学习,把学业水平考试的内容巧妙地融合到体育课程教学中,做到学考一体,学生学会了体育项目并得到了健康发展。针对现有的课程设计和课程实施存在的问题提出了建议,首先提高普通高中学校对体育课程的注重程度,对体育教师的管理培训要更加合理,提高教师教学工作的热情,完善学校场地器材等教学媒介;其次部分学校要增加体育课程的课时安排,完善课程设计,在课程内容的选择安排上下功夫。
高校在线课程考试系统的设计与开发
这是一篇关于在线考试,组卷,课程,J2EE的论文, 主要内容为随着Internet/Intranet的技术和应用的飞速发展,作为教育评价的考试也正经历着无纸化和网络化的飞跃。在线课程考试系统是将计算机和网络通信技术应用到教学领域的产物,利用Web资源,给考生、评卷人和出题者带来巨大的便利,同时也为高校的教育教学改革提供了有力地支持。 本系统的采用B/S模式,设计和开发采用跨平台的J2EE多层架构和开源的Linux系统、MySQL数据库技术和JAVA开发工具Eclipse来进行,使用了MVC开发模式、面向对象的分析和设计方法,有很高的稳定性、可用性、可维护性、可扩展性、可移植性和较低的部署成本。 论文介绍了国内外网上考试系统的研究现状和不足,给出了高校在线课程考试系统需求分析,包括功能分析、用例分析、数据流分析和性能分析。论文对考试系统的具体设计内容进行了详细论述,包括总体设计、数据库设计、各功能模块的设计,如系统管理模块、考生管理模块、制作试卷模块、试卷管理模块、在线考试模块、成绩管理模块等的设计,并给出了部分关键代码。 论文针对考试系统设计实现中的关键技术问题进行了讨论并给出了自己的解决方案。对关系系统性能的组卷算法,针对组卷算法的多约束条件问题求解的特点,减少无效试卷在组卷过程中的组卷次数,以降低系统开销,引入了回溯代价的概念,提出了基于最小回溯代价的智能组卷算法,分析了组卷算法的数学模型,通过优先选择具有最小回溯代价的单元试题,以最大可能地降低无效试卷在组卷过程中所产生的开销,从而确保算法的有效性。采用基于最小回溯代价的智能组卷算法能够获得较满意的组卷效率。 在系统设计过程中采用了目前广泛流行的MVC设计模型作为系统开发的技术方案。设计中使用JavaBeans组件来搭建应用程序,通过JavaBean来存储考生信息、试卷信息和考生答案等,减少JSP页面中代码的数量,使系统具有通用性、良好的可扩展性和安全性、并易于维护等优点。
基于web的高校教学管理系统设计与实现
这是一篇关于JSP,数据库,课程,教学管理的论文, 主要内容为随着各大高校的不断扩招,学生人数不断增加,而每个学生的选修课程各不相同,导致固定时间、固定人员的课程安排非常困难。为此,需要转变教学机制,由原来传统的教学模式转变为全开放式教学模式。高校教学管理系统可以使学生自由灵活的安排课程时间。但是,由于学生人数不等,所选课程也不尽相同,这就给教学的准备工作带来了种种不便。因此,迫切需要开发相应的教学管理系统来实现开放交互式课程教学。高校教学管理系统配合JSP、JAVAScript编程等网络新技术,服务器端与客户端的交互式连接,可以使学生自由选择课程时间并进行预约和查询,预先了解各项课程内容,提前熟悉所需要教学,从而可大大提高高校教学的效果和学生的积极性。 基于网络页面的高校教学管理系统在校园内任意一台联网计算机上,学生可以进行在网上预约课程、查询课程,以及各个教室的做课程安排 系统采用浏览器—网络页面服务器—数据库服务器的三层分布式结构,建立基于网络页面的高校教学管理系统是一个高校教育单位不可缺少的部分。一个功能齐全、简单易用的教学管理系统不但能有效地减轻学校各类工作人员的工作负担,它的内容对于学校的决策者和管理者来说都至关重要。
高校在线课程考试系统的设计与开发
这是一篇关于在线考试,组卷,课程,J2EE的论文, 主要内容为随着Internet/Intranet的技术和应用的飞速发展,作为教育评价的考试也正经历着无纸化和网络化的飞跃。在线课程考试系统是将计算机和网络通信技术应用到教学领域的产物,利用Web资源,给考生、评卷人和出题者带来巨大的便利,同时也为高校的教育教学改革提供了有力地支持。 本系统的采用B/S模式,设计和开发采用跨平台的J2EE多层架构和开源的Linux系统、MySQL数据库技术和JAVA开发工具Eclipse来进行,使用了MVC开发模式、面向对象的分析和设计方法,有很高的稳定性、可用性、可维护性、可扩展性、可移植性和较低的部署成本。 论文介绍了国内外网上考试系统的研究现状和不足,给出了高校在线课程考试系统需求分析,包括功能分析、用例分析、数据流分析和性能分析。论文对考试系统的具体设计内容进行了详细论述,包括总体设计、数据库设计、各功能模块的设计,如系统管理模块、考生管理模块、制作试卷模块、试卷管理模块、在线考试模块、成绩管理模块等的设计,并给出了部分关键代码。 论文针对考试系统设计实现中的关键技术问题进行了讨论并给出了自己的解决方案。对关系系统性能的组卷算法,针对组卷算法的多约束条件问题求解的特点,减少无效试卷在组卷过程中的组卷次数,以降低系统开销,引入了回溯代价的概念,提出了基于最小回溯代价的智能组卷算法,分析了组卷算法的数学模型,通过优先选择具有最小回溯代价的单元试题,以最大可能地降低无效试卷在组卷过程中所产生的开销,从而确保算法的有效性。采用基于最小回溯代价的智能组卷算法能够获得较满意的组卷效率。 在系统设计过程中采用了目前广泛流行的MVC设计模型作为系统开发的技术方案。设计中使用JavaBeans组件来搭建应用程序,通过JavaBean来存储考生信息、试卷信息和考生答案等,减少JSP页面中代码的数量,使系统具有通用性、良好的可扩展性和安全性、并易于维护等优点。
高校在线课程考试系统的设计与开发
这是一篇关于在线考试,组卷,课程,J2EE的论文, 主要内容为随着Internet/Intranet的技术和应用的飞速发展,作为教育评价的考试也正经历着无纸化和网络化的飞跃。在线课程考试系统是将计算机和网络通信技术应用到教学领域的产物,利用Web资源,给考生、评卷人和出题者带来巨大的便利,同时也为高校的教育教学改革提供了有力地支持。 本系统的采用B/S模式,设计和开发采用跨平台的J2EE多层架构和开源的Linux系统、MySQL数据库技术和JAVA开发工具Eclipse来进行,使用了MVC开发模式、面向对象的分析和设计方法,有很高的稳定性、可用性、可维护性、可扩展性、可移植性和较低的部署成本。 论文介绍了国内外网上考试系统的研究现状和不足,给出了高校在线课程考试系统需求分析,包括功能分析、用例分析、数据流分析和性能分析。论文对考试系统的具体设计内容进行了详细论述,包括总体设计、数据库设计、各功能模块的设计,如系统管理模块、考生管理模块、制作试卷模块、试卷管理模块、在线考试模块、成绩管理模块等的设计,并给出了部分关键代码。 论文针对考试系统设计实现中的关键技术问题进行了讨论并给出了自己的解决方案。对关系系统性能的组卷算法,针对组卷算法的多约束条件问题求解的特点,减少无效试卷在组卷过程中的组卷次数,以降低系统开销,引入了回溯代价的概念,提出了基于最小回溯代价的智能组卷算法,分析了组卷算法的数学模型,通过优先选择具有最小回溯代价的单元试题,以最大可能地降低无效试卷在组卷过程中所产生的开销,从而确保算法的有效性。采用基于最小回溯代价的智能组卷算法能够获得较满意的组卷效率。 在系统设计过程中采用了目前广泛流行的MVC设计模型作为系统开发的技术方案。设计中使用JavaBeans组件来搭建应用程序,通过JavaBean来存储考生信息、试卷信息和考生答案等,减少JSP页面中代码的数量,使系统具有通用性、良好的可扩展性和安全性、并易于维护等优点。
本文内容包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主题。发布者:毕业设计客栈 ,原文地址:https://bishedaima.com/lunwen/47120.html